    A $23 million verdict by a jury was awarded to an 81-year-old steamfitter with mesothelioma who worked as a steamfitter. Jenkins Bros. was found to be 100% responsible by the jury. The jury also found Johns Manville responsible for 10 percent of the award.

    Another notable case in New York was a $5 million settlement won by the family of an ex- Navy boiler technician. The suit was filed against Burnham LLC, which manufactured the boilers on which the technician worked. The lawsuit also included wrongful death damages, which can be used to cover funeral expenses and lost income.

    Women have also filed lawsuits, though the majority of them were men who were exposed at work to asbestos. These lawsuits are based upon secondary exposure. This happens when a loved one inhaled asbestos fibers from hair or clothing belonging to someone who had worked with asbestos.

    Statute of Limitations

    Mesothelioma claims are subject to state statutes of limitations and the deadlines are subject to change. An experienced lawyer can help patients understand the deadlines in their state. It is essential that victims file their claims as quickly as they can. It's important that victims file as early as possible.

    Mesothelioma can take years to develop in asbestos exposed victims. Due to this, the statute of limitations is a key consideration. Mesothelioma lawyers can explain state laws and how they apply to the asbestos exposure case of the victim.

    In general, the statute of limitations begins when a mesothelioma patient is diagnosed. The clock could start earlier, depending on a number of factors. The condition that the victim was in as well as the location of the asbestos exposure site, and the time of exposure are all important factors to take into account.
